位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

为什么有的excel需要启用宏

作者:excel百科网
|
80人看过
发布时间:2026-01-11 03:53:01
标签:
为什么有的Excel需要启用宏在使用Excel进行数据处理和分析时,我们常常会遇到一些操作需要特定的设置。其中,启用宏(VBA)是一个重要的功能。Excel宏是一种编程语言,允许用户编写脚本来自动化重复性任务,提高工作效率。因此,有些
为什么有的excel需要启用宏
为什么有的Excel需要启用宏
在使用Excel进行数据处理和分析时,我们常常会遇到一些操作需要特定的设置。其中,启用宏(VBA)是一个重要的功能。Excel宏是一种编程语言,允许用户编写脚本来自动化重复性任务,提高工作效率。因此,有些Excel文件需要启用宏,这是为了确保用户能够充分利用其功能。本文将全面探讨为什么有些Excel文件需要启用宏,以及它们在实际应用中的价值。
一、宏的基本概念与功能
Excel宏是一种自动化脚本,用户可以通过VBA(Visual Basic for Applications)编写宏来执行特定操作。宏可以完成以下几类任务:
1. 数据处理:例如,批量导入数据、清理数据、排序、筛选等。
2. 图表生成:自动创建图表、更新图表数据、调整图表样式等。
3. 公式计算:执行复杂的公式,如财务计算、统计分析等。
4. 报表生成:自动生成报表、汇总数据、生成统计报告等。
5. 数据可视化:将数据以图表形式展示,支持多种图表类型。
宏的主要优势在于自动化,减少了手动操作的繁琐,提高了工作效率。然而,宏的使用也需要一定的编程知识,因此并非所有Excel文件都需要启用宏。
二、为什么某些Excel文件需要启用宏?
在Excel中,某些文件需要启用宏,主要原因包括以下几点:
1. 宏功能的必要性
部分Excel文件包含复杂的逻辑和操作,这些操作需要宏来实现。例如,一个用于财务分析的Excel文件,可能包含多个自动计算的公式、数据筛选、图表更新等功能,这些功能只有在启用宏后才能正常运行。
2. 宏的自定义功能
宏允许用户自定义操作流程,包括数据处理、公式计算、图表生成等。如果没有启用宏,这些功能可能无法实现,因此需要启用宏。
3. 兼容性和功能扩展
一些Excel文件可能包含第三方插件或外部数据源,这些功能需要宏来支持。例如,某些数据分析工具或数据导入功能,只有在启用宏后才能正常运行。
4. 安全性与权限设置
Excel宏的安全设置决定了是否允许宏运行。如果文件中包含宏,用户需要在Excel中启用宏,以确保其功能能够正常使用。如果不启用宏,某些功能将无法使用。
5. 特定业务需求
在某些行业或企业中,Excel文件用于处理特定业务流程,例如销售数据、库存管理、财务报表等。这些流程可能需要定制化的宏来实现特定的业务逻辑,因此需要启用宏。
三、启用宏的步骤与注意事项
启用宏的步骤相对简单,但需要注意以下几点:
1. 启用宏的权限设置:在Excel中,用户需要在“文件”菜单中选择“选项” > “信任中心” > “信任中心设置” > “启用宏”。
2. 宏的兼容性:宏文件通常以`.xlsm`为扩展名,用户需要确保其兼容性,避免因版本不一致导致宏无法运行。
3. 宏的安全性:宏文件可能会携带潜在威胁,用户需要在启用宏前进行检查,确保其来源可靠。
4. 宏的调试与测试:启用宏后,用户需要测试宏的功能是否正常,确保其不会影响其他操作或数据。
四、宏的优缺点分析
宏虽然功能强大,但也存在一些局限性,用户在使用时应权衡其优缺点:
1. 优点
- 提高效率:宏可以自动执行重复性操作,减少手动输入。
- 增强功能:宏可以实现复杂的业务逻辑,满足特定需求。
- 数据整合与分析:宏可以整合多个数据源,进行数据清洗和分析。
2. 缺点
- 安全性风险:宏可能携带恶意代码,导致数据泄露或系统被入侵。
- 学习成本:宏的使用需要一定的编程知识,学习曲线较陡。
- 兼容性问题:不同版本的Excel对宏的支持可能不同,可能导致运行问题。
五、宏的使用场景与案例
在实际工作中,宏的使用非常广泛,以下是一些典型的应用场景:
1. 财务报表生成
在财务分析中,宏可以自动汇总数据、生成报表、更新图表等。例如,某公司使用宏来自动计算月度财务报表,并根据数据变化自动更新图表。
2. 数据清洗与处理
宏可以自动清洗数据,如去除重复数据、填充缺失值、转换数据格式等。对于大量数据处理,宏能够显著提高效率。
3. 自动化数据分析
在市场营销中,宏可以用于自动分析用户行为数据、生成客户画像、预测销售趋势等。宏的使用使得数据分析更加高效。
4. 自动化报告生成
在企业中,宏可以用于自动生成销售报告、库存报告、绩效报告等,减少人工输入和错误。
六、宏的未来发展与趋势
随着Excel功能的不断扩展,宏的使用也在发生变化。未来,宏可能会向更智能化的方向发展,例如:
- AI驱动的宏:借助AI技术,宏可以自动识别数据模式,实现更智能的自动化处理。
- 云协作与共享:宏可以在云平台中协同工作,实现多人实时编辑和共享。
- 更丰富的功能:宏将支持更多数据处理和分析功能,如机器学习、自然语言处理等。
七、用户使用宏的注意事项
对于普通用户来说,使用宏需要一定的学习和实践,以下是几个建议:
1. 学习基础语法:掌握VBA的基本语法,如变量、循环、条件判断等。
2. 测试宏的运行:在启用宏前,应先在小数据集上测试宏,确保其不会影响数据。
3. 保护文件安全:使用“保护工作表”或“保护工作簿”功能,防止未经授权的更改。
4. 定期更新宏:随着Excel版本更新,宏可能需要调整,用户应定期检查并更新。
八、总结
Excel宏是一种强大的工具,能够显著提高工作效率,满足复杂业务需求。然而,宏的使用也需要用户具备一定的技术能力,并注意其安全性和兼容性。对于需要启用宏的Excel文件,用户应充分了解其功能和使用方法,合理规划使用场景,以实现最佳效果。
通过合理使用宏,用户可以在Excel中获得更高效、更智能的数据处理体验。无论是日常办公还是企业级数据分析,宏都是一项不可或缺的工具。
推荐文章
相关文章
推荐URL
为什么拖动Excel表会延时?深度解析Excel操作延迟背后的原理与优化策略在日常工作和学习中,Excel作为一款功能强大的电子表格工具,广泛应用于数据处理、财务分析、项目管理等多个领域。但很多人在使用Excel时,会遇到一个常见问题
2026-01-11 03:52:56
81人看过
Excel打印为什么隐藏内容:深度解析与实用技巧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在使用 Excel 时,用户常常会遇到“隐藏内容”这一概念,它既是一种数据保护手段,也是一种数
2026-01-11 03:52:53
294人看过
为什么WPS打不开Excel表格:深度解析与解决方案在日常办公中,Excel表格是数据处理和分析的重要工具。然而,当用户在使用WPS Office时遇到“打不开Excel表格”的问题,往往让人感到困惑和沮丧。本文将从多个角度深入分析这
2026-01-11 03:52:33
267人看过
Excel取消换行的正确操作方法在Excel中,表格的排版是一项基本而重要的技能。无论是数据整理、公式应用,还是图表制作,合理的排版都能提升数据的可读性和使用效率。而“取消换行”正是在表格编辑过程中经常需要进行的操作。本文将详细介绍E
2026-01-11 03:52:25
115人看过
热门推荐
热门专题:
资讯中心: